Download or read book The Comedies written by Terence, and published by Oxford University Press, USA. This book was released on 2008-01-10 with total page 372 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Roman playwright Terence is one of the founding fathers of European comic drama. This new translation of all six of his comedies brings out their liveliness and performability and sets them in the context of Latin literature and the history of comic drama.
